Newly Developed Soft-PWM Control
Mitsubishi’s Soft-PWM switching system keeps noise to a minimum
(as low as a Mitsubishi FR-Z Series inverter).
Note: The default setting is Soft-PWM control.

Without Soft-PWM
Since the frequency components are
dispersed, the motor generates little
metallic noise and does not sound
unpleasant.
Since the frequency components are
concentrated, the motor generates a
grating metallic noise.

Compatibility with 240V and 480V Power
Supply Now Standard
Full Line-Up of Capacities Available
The FR-E500 is the first line-up in its class to include 5.5kW and
7.5kW capacities, which extends the range to 0.1–7.5kW.
Compatible with Single-Phase Power Supplies
Compatible with single phase 100V and 200V as well as three-phase
200V and 400V power supplies. (Output is three-phase 200V.)
Compatibility with Data Communications Also
Standard
We've added RS-485 communications functionality as standard,
so you can control operations via data communications once the
control panel is removed.

Ample Protection Functions for Safer Operation
Instantaneous power failure stop restart function: Can start while
coasting.
Built-in electronic overcurrent protection
Alarm retry selection
Compatible with Numerous I/Os
Multi-speed operation (15 speeds)
4 to 20mA input
Multi-input terminals: Select four inputs from 11 possible input
types
Multi-output terminals: Select three outputs from 12 possible
output types
24V external power supply output (permissible values: 24V DC
0.1A)
Operating Functions
JOG operation
Frequency jumps (three points): Avoid the machine’s resonant
frequency
Other Convenient Functions
Fast acceleration/deceleration mode
Full monitoring: Monitors actual operating time and more
Second functions: Switch between two sets of motor
characteristics
Zero current detection
